Acoustic panels are specially designed materials used to manage sound in interior spaces. They work by absorbing sound waves, thereby reducing noise levels and preventing echo. These panels are particularly beneficial in settings such as auditoriums, recording studios, offices, and even homes, where controlling sound is crucial for both comfort and functionality.
One of the primary advantages of using acoustic panels is their ability to improve speech intelligibility. In environments with high levels of background noise, conversations can become muddled, leading to misunderstandings and frustration. Acoustic panels help mitigate this issue by absorbing excess sound, allowing for clearer communication. This is especially vital in workspaces where team collaboration and discussion are essential.
Additionally, acoustic panels contribute to the overall aesthetic of a space. They come in a wide variety of materials, colors, and designs, allowing architects and interior designers to integrate them seamlessly into their vision. From fabric-wrapped panels to wood finishes, these elements can complement or enhance the overall design theme of a room while serving a functional purpose.
Another significant benefit of acoustic panels is their contribution to occupant well-being. Excessive noise can lead to stress, decreased productivity, and even health problems. By incorporating acoustic panels into a design, spaces can become more tranquil, promoting a peaceful atmosphere that enhances focus and relaxation. This is particularly important in environments like healthcare facilities, where noise reduction can directly impact patient recovery and comfort.
Moreover, acoustic panels play a role in sustainable design. Many manufacturers produce panels using eco-friendly materials and methods, contributing to a building’s overall sustainability. By reducing noise pollution, these panels enhance the user experience without compromising environmental integrity.
When selecting acoustic panels, it’s essential to consider factors such as the specific sound issues present in the space, the design requirements, and the desired level of absorption. Consulting with professionals in the field can help ensure that you choose the right materials and designs to meet your needs effectively.
In conclusion, acoustic panels are a vital component of modern architecture and design. Their ability to enhance sound quality, improve aesthetics, promote occupant well-being, and support sustainable practices makes them an invaluable asset in various environments. By understanding the importance of acoustic panels, you can create spaces that are not only beautiful but also functional and comfortable for their users.
